Case Study

CAMPUS & MAJOR Series

Designed with purpose, made for the Otis community.

This tote bag project began with a clear goal: to create upcycled merchandise that connects student-created work with the Otis community while emphasizing sustainability. Inspired by the negative space in the Otis logo, the design features a three-pocket layout that balances style and everyday functionality.

Each bag is crafted from recycled campus pole banners and includes illustrations by Otis alum Genesis Otero (‘24 BFA Animation). Throughout the process, we explored sustainable production methods and collaborated closely with Otis stakeholders to refine both design and manufacturing goals. Working with thick banner material challenged us to develop efficient, hands-on solutions that brought the design to life.

To support the launch, we produced a promotional video and designed a window vinyl display for the campus store. These efforts contributed to selling 60 bags within the first month.

More than just a product, this tote reflects our collaboration, problem-solving, and strong connection to the Otis community.
